Friday night, the mood was decidedly celebratory at a GOP Lincoln Day Dinner fundraiser held at President Trump’s Mar-a-Lago estate in Palm Beach, Florida. Hours before the scheduled dinner, the Mueller report was released to Attorney General William Barr with no new indictments.
The President and First Lady attended the fundraiser and Trump spoke briefly, though he did not mention the Mueller report. Among his comments, he marveled at the First Lady’s poll numbers.
President Trump introduced Sen. Lindsey Graham as the keynote speaker in pure Trump-style.
An interesting development over the last several months is the strengthening bond between Trump and Graham.
The 2016 Republican primary campaign found Graham and Trump sparring among the many candidates who were vying for the presidential nomination. At times, it was biting and personal. Graham continued criticizing Trump’s decisions long after he took over the Oval Office.
Now, however, it seems that Graham has become one of the President’s strongest and most outspoken allies on Capitol Hill.
Trump did joke that he was there because of Lindsey. “If Lindsey’s speaking,” he said, “I want to come here for two reasons. Number one, he’s a great speaker. And number two, he’s not going to say anything bad about me.”
During Graham’s speech, he called for an investigation into Clinton and the origins of the infamous and debunked dossier.
He hit a nerve with attendees, as a spirited “lock her up” chant broke out. Reportedly, Trey Gowdy was leading the chant from the head table.
